What Is Full-Arch Replacement?



Full-arch replacement is an oral treatment designed to bring back a whole arc of missing out on teeth, usually in the top or reduced jaw. This process includes using dental implants or a repaired prosthesis, which can substantially boost your dental function and aesthetic appearance.

If cosmetic dentist st pete missing out on most or all of your teeth, this choice could be optimal for you, as it gives a secure and long lasting remedy.

During the procedure, your dental professional will evaluate your jawbone's wellness and structure. If essential, they'll do bone grafting to guarantee there suffices assistance for the implants.

Hereafter, they'll place the implants right into the jawbone, functioning as roots for your new teeth. You'll after that wait for the implants to integrate with the bone, a procedure called osseointegration, which can take several months.

Benefits of Full-Arch Substitute



Choosing a full-arch replacement includes various advantages that can considerably enhance your lifestyle.

Firstly, you'll experience enhanced feature; eating and talking ended up being a lot easier with a steady, tooth-supported structure. You won't need to fret about loose dentures slipping or creating discomfort throughout dishes.

Cosmetically, full-arch substitutes can considerably enhance your self-confidence. With a natural-looking smile, you'll feel extra comfy mingling and engaging with others. This can cause improved self-esteem and a more favorable outlook on life.

Furthermore, full-arch substitutes are created to last, supplying you with a lasting remedy for missing teeth. Unlike conventional dentures, which might require frequent changes, these substitutes frequently call for much less maintenance in time.

In addition, many individuals see improvements in total oral health and wellness after the treatment. By replacing missing out on teeth, you're reducing the risk of bone loss and preserving face structure. This can result in an extra youthful look as you age.

After surgical procedure, there's always a possibility that microorganisms might go into the surgical site, bring about complications.

You may likewise experience blood loss, which, while generally workable, can occasionally require more intervention.

Another concern is nerve damages. During the treatment, neighboring nerves can be affected, resulting in tingling or pain. This may solve in time, but sometimes, it can result in long-term issues.



Furthermore, you may deal with issues related to the implants themselves. These can include helping to loosen, fracture, or failing of the prosthetic, requiring added surgical procedures.
